    As a Developer at MailOnline, the world largest newspaper website dailymail.co.uk, you will be a part of delivering our mission to inform, educate, entertain and inspire 230 million people from 200+ countries. You will work in small cross-functional teams using a range of tools – we have a philosophy of using the right tool for the right job here rather than strict adherence to standards. We are migrating from Java towards NodeJS and Clojure. We favour lightweight tools and libraries over frameworks. Our teams share ownership of the design through to the delivery of the products. You will be actively encouraged to learn the new skills and you will quickly see the value of your contribution with millions of people visiting our website – all our developers find it very satisfying.
